Applications
Automotive specialty coatings are widely used in engine components, exhaust systems, transmissions, interior parts, wheel rims, and under-the-hood applications. In engines and exhaust systems, they provide thermal stability and corrosion protection, while interior and exterior applications benefit from enhanced appearance and wear resistance. Their use is expanding as vehicles integrate advanced powertrain and transmission technologies.
Trends
A key trend shaping the market is the shift toward environmentally friendly and low-VOC coating technologies, driven by tightening emission regulations. Automakers are also increasing the use of specialty coatings on lightweight materials such as plastics and aluminum to support fuel efficiency and emission reduction goals. Continuous innovation in coating formulations is improving performance under high-temperature and high-stress conditions.
